What key function do we use on Window Vista to upload multiple photos in one go instead of each individual photos?

Answer #1

Hold Ctrl or Shift when you go to pick an attachment. This has to be in Firefox, Chrome, or Safari. I just learned that today :) Ctrl let’s you pick individually, and Shift will select anything between the first and the last thing you click on.
